ROLLING MILLS Consist of a pair of heavy backing rolls surrounded by a large number of planetary rolls. Each planetary roll gives an almost constant reduction to the slab as it sweeps out a circular path between the backing rolls and the slab. In steel plants reheating furnaces are used in hot rolling mills to heat the steel stock (Billets, blooms or slabs) to temperatures of around 1200 deg C which is suitable for plastic deformation of steel and hence for rolling in the mill. WhatsApp: +86 18037808511In the process of copper alloy hot continuous rolling, the problem of copper sticking to the roller seriously affects the surface quality, performance, and service life of the copper products. Roll sticking occurs as the adhesion energy of Cu is lower than that of Fe and the FeCu interface, and the severe surface deformation which forces the copper into direct contact with the roll during the ...

WhatsApp: +86 18037808511Slab Mill Here slab is produced from the bloom. t>b and b=100mm Plate Mill Here plate is produced from the slab. t>4mm. Sheet Mill Here sheet is produced from plate. t<4mm. Structural Mill Here structural shapes like I, U,L or channel sections are produced. Metal flow pattern in Rolling

WhatsApp: +86 18037808511Rolling Mills Configurations Twohigh: two opposing large diameter rolls Threehigh: work passes through both directions Dr. M. Medraj Mech 421/6511 lecture 5/8 Rolling Mills Configurations Fourhigh: backing rolls support smaller work rolls Cluster mill: multiple backing rolls on smaller rolls Tandem rolling mill: sequence of twohigh mills

WhatsApp: +86 18037808511Roll pass design is a set of methods for determining the dimensions, shape, number, and type of arrangement of rolling mill passes. Roll pass design also includes the calculation of pressing forces and their distribution on the roll passes.
